Boat Delivery May 2021

Hello all,
We are purchasing a 50' Jeanneau 509 that we will keep at its current location, South Amboy, NJ, till May of 2021. We are looking for a captain & 1 crew member to sail the boat to Mystic CT around 5/8-5/14 next year. The boat is well equipped with all you would expect. Does anyone have a recommendation of a licensed captain. We have been told it is about an 18 hour trip. Thank you.

Re: Boat Delivery May 2021

This is a relatively easy passage. You need to time the currents through the East River and Hell gate but otherwise nothing special. If you wish to break up the trip you can grab a free mooring for a night in Manhasset Bay just past the Throgs neck Bridge, Anchor at City Island or travel a little further and anchor in Oyster Bay.
